We define a framework as a static multi dimensional taxonomy to store information in some temporal state. 

In other words, a framework is a container with many compartments that can hold information at some point in time. The maxim "you can't teach an old dog new tricks" is making reference to the static state of your internal framework and its contents as a static reference model. For our purpose, a 'reference model' is simply a populated framework.